Problem with armor creation [1.16.4]
Deferred Registers, well, defer the registration. so anytime before the common setup event, the object won't have been registered yet. what you can do is, instead of giving the enum the item instance, give them a Supplier of the Item. since the RegistryObject class implements Supplier, you can just pass the RegistryObject. then whenever you need the actual item, you call .get()

[1.16.5] Extending the base class of the player and drawing the screen when entering the world or server
https://mcforge.readthedocs.io/en/latest/datastorage/capabilities/ Capabilities are a way to store additional data to certain objects, you can create a class that holds the data and behaviour that you want, then register it to the capability manager
-
[1.16.5] Extending the base class of the player and drawing the screen when entering the world or server
I'm thinking you can use capabilities. create a clas that has what you want, then attach it to the player with a default value that indicates the player hasn't picked a class yet next you can listen to the EntityJoinWorldEvent, check if the entity is a player and if the value is the default one, if it is send a packet to the client telling them to render this screen, then from the screen you can update the player capability
